Federal Minister for Health Mustafa Kamal paid a surprise visit to the Cardiac Center of Pakistan Institute of Medical Sciences (PIMS) and reviewed the facilities, medical services and administrative matters available to patients there.

The Health Minister also inspected the Electrophysiology Cath Lab during the visit. He got information from the medical staff about the modern cardiac facilities provided at the centre.

Mustafa Kamal also spoke to the patients and their carers. He got first-hand information about the difficulties faced during treatment and the facilities available at the hospital.

An important aspect of the visit was the review of the hospital building and maintenance. The Health Minister expressed concern over the condition of the private rooms of the Cardiac Centre.

During the inspection, attention was drawn to a damaged wall. The Health Minister questioned how the problem could be solved with just paint if there is a defect in the basic structure.

He was of the view that the maintenance of the hospital should not be limited to mere superficial repairs. It is the responsibility of the administration to identify such defects in a timely manner and permanently resolve them.

Mustafa Kamal made it clear to PIMS Executive Director DrDr Salman that the new administration would not be given a long time to understand the hospital system. According to him, it is necessary to start practical steps immediately.

The Health Minister also directed the administration to monitor the repair and maintenance work on a daily basis. He said that the defect in the basic facilities of the hospital could create more problems for the patients.

He also stressedtaking action against ineffective staff. According to him, a decision should be taken against an employee who is not fulfilling his responsibility as per the rules.

Mustafa Kamal also rejected the impression of giving priority to any kind of affiliation over performance in this matter. He directed the administration to identify the non-performing staff and take action as required.

Another issue related to the management structure of PIMS also came to light during the visit. The administration said that decision-making and administrative powers are largely concentrated at a single level.

The Health Minister sought a written proposal on the issue. He asked the administration to submit a brief plan on the division of powers and a better management model for the hospital.

This review at PIMS has taken place at a time when the government’s focus on the hospital’s administrative performance, patient comfort and security arrangements has increased. After recent incidents, the federal government has stressedimproving facilities and security measures in hospitals.

Various specialisedspecialised services, including electrophysiology, are available at the cardiac centrecentre of PIMS. According to official information from the centre, there are several facilities here, including cardiac emergency, cath lab, electrophysiology, cardiology ward and private ward.

In such a situation, administrative problems can have a direct impact on patient care. Therefore, the health minister’s visit focused on building maintenance, staff performance and decision-making systems, along with medical facilities.
